SHOW NOTES:

On this episode of the Collaborative IEP podcast,  we continue on our deep dive into the intricacies of IDEA Section 1415, focusing on procedural safeguards. We’ll explore essential details on notification requirements, prior written notices, due process complaints, mediation processes, and impartial due process hearings. Discover how to effectively handle these procedural safeguards to ensure you are well-prepared for your next IEP meeting.
